    Native riparian zone trees along our streams and rivers are the most important factor for the food chain of trout. Most fishermen would not have noticed the native riparian zone trees on the streambank where you caught brown trout over 12 inches in this video. Check at around 20:00 and 35:00 the trees overhanging the stream where your bigger brown trout were caught. Bring along a freshly cut black willow tree walking stick and plant your walking stick where the stream needs some shade, protect an eroding stream bank, and provide the needed nutrition in the food chain of big brown trout.

    Any suggestions on where to fly fish in Wisconsin? Visiting home from CO and would love to get on some Wisconsin trouts

    • @WisconsinTroutFishing
      @WisconsinTroutFishing  ห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      The best suggestion I have is to check out the WI DNR website for the county maps where you will be in WI. All streams are mapped and listed. The T.R.O.U.T tool they have is a live map with public access and easements. I suggest this as easements in WI are often habitat managed for fly fishing and may give greater access for casting etc. Less bushwhacking with a 10 foot pole. Lots of rain here recently and more coming. Not much fishable water at the moment. Happy fishing!

    Hello, can you tell me what kind of fishing rod you use? I like your videos, greetings from Poland

    • @WisconsinTroutFishing
      @WisconsinTroutFishing  ห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      Thanks. I use a 5'6" medium power, fast action, 2 piece Shimano FX series rod. FXS56MC2. It's a very inexpensive rod at less than $20. What I really like about the FX rods is the eyelets and guides. They will not wear from braided line at all. For lake run fish I use a larger version FXS66MHB2. Happy fishing!
